Transaction 93b68f4701fa831f7521f5a5a9adb2086254d1c2110d8fe5be98eb46aec66f20
1 Input
1 Output
-
93b68f4701fa831f7521f5a5a9adb2086254d1c2110d8fe5be98eb46aec66f20:0
- value
- 139826
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c407d3f438f6a3d177bf5261b09b978f5f4216ef O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JsWpVebrzRpCQyhPNeh7Hytq564dg8wX3